What is the median home price in Emlyn?

The median home value in Emlyn is $107k. The median monthly rent is $1,011. Annual property taxes average $428. Home values are based on U.S. Census Bureau American Community Survey estimates.

Are home values rising in Emlyn?

Home values in Emlyn have increased 12.2% over the past two years. This indicates a strong appreciation trend. This data is sourced from the Federal Housing Finance Agency (FHFA) House Price Index.

How much income do you need to buy a home in Emlyn?

Based on a typical all-in ownership cost of $501/month (mortgage, taxes, insurance), you'd generally need a household income of approximately $21k/year to keep housing costs at or below 28% of gross income — a common lender guideline. The median household income in Emlyn is $47k/year.

What industries drive the economy in Emlyn?

The largest employment sectors in Emlyn are public administration (27%) and retail (17%) of the local workforce. Industry data is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au American Community Survey.
